【绘图】比Matplotlib更强大:ProPlot
全部标签 我正在iOS中进行绘图,我的代码可以正常工作,绘图工作正常,现在我已经实现了撤消和重做功能,但实际情况是这样的,假设我画了两条线,然后按撤消按钮,然后绘制的第一条线变得模糊,我不明白为什么会这样,下面是我的撤消代码。-(void)redrawLine{UIGraphicsBeginImageContext(self.bounds.size);[self.layerrenderInContext:UIGraphicsGetCurrentContext()];NSDictionary*lineInfo=[lineArraylastObject];curImage=(UIImage*)[li
目录scrapy框架pipeline-itrm-shellscrapy模拟登录scrapy下载图片下载中间件scrapy框架含义:构图: 运行流程:1.scrapy框架拿到start_urls构造了一个request请求2.request请求发送给scrapy引擎,中途路过爬虫中间件,引擎再发送request给调度器(一个队列存储request请求)3.调度器再把requst请求发送给引擎4.引擎再把requst请求发送给下载器,中途经过下载中间件5.下载器然后访问互联网然后返回response响应6.下载器把得到的response发送给引擎,中途经过下载中间件7.引擎发送resonse给爬虫
写在前面两年前我做了第一个开源软件DreamScene2动态桌面,如今受到了很多人的喜欢,这增加了我继续做好开源软件的信心。之前的这个软件一直有人希望我加入一个设置屏保壁纸的功能,因为DreamScene2就是一个单纯的动态桌面的软件,所以一直没有加入这个功能。今天我带来一个新的开源软件,软件依然是小而强大,简洁并且快速。欢迎Star和Fork:https://github.com/he55/SonomaWallpaper介绍SonomaWallpaper是首款将macOSSonoma4k120帧动态屏保壁纸带到Windows11的软件,壁纸包含了自然景观、城市景观、水下景观和地球四个主题的屏
Matplotlib绘图技巧(二)写在前面2.函数间区域填充函数fill_between()和fill()参数:3.散点图scatter4.直方图hist5.条形图bar5.1一个数据样本的条形图参数:5.2多个数据样本进行对比的直方图5.3水平条形图参数5.4绘制不同数据样本进行对比的水平条形图5.5堆叠条形图6.等高线图meshgrid写在前面前面我们讲过,好的图表在论文写作中是相当重要的,这里学姐为继续为大家分享一些Matplotlib快速入门内容以及论文绘图的技巧,帮助大家快速学习绘图。这里整理了完整的文档与技巧,有需要的同学看文章最后,另外,如果没有美赛经验想要获奖,欢迎咨询哦~2.
1应用商店安装NocalhostServer已集成在KubeSphere应用商店,直接访问:设置应用「名称」,确认应用「版本」和部署「位置」,点击「下一步」:在「应用设置」标签页,可手动编辑清单文件或直接点击「安装」。建议把service.type设置为ClusterIP,以确保安装不受Kubernetes网络环境影响。可结合自身研发环境来选择使用NodePort或LoadBalancer服务类型来暴露NocalhostServer。完成操作,开始创建:片刻后:2暴露服务进入「应用负载」下的「服务」页面,选择nocalhost-web服务,在最右侧的拉下菜单中选择「编辑外部访问」:在弹出的对话
在最近的iOStechtalk中,我听到了关于“确保您的绘制操作是像素对齐的”的建议。这是对Mac/iOS绘图性能的有效建议吗?另一个问题是我如何确定我的代码是像素对齐绘制的?有什么工具或技巧可以提供帮助吗? 最佳答案 像素对齐与性能无关,但与渲染图形的质量有关。解释它的最好方法是显示一点代码://AssumethisisdrawinginarectsuchasabuttonorotherNSViewNSBezierPath*line=[NSBezierPathbezierPath];[linemoveToPoint:NSMakeP
1应用商店安装NocalhostServer已集成在KubeSphere应用商店,直接访问:设置应用「名称」,确认应用「版本」和部署「位置」,点击「下一步」:在「应用设置」标签页,可手动编辑清单文件或直接点击「安装」。建议把service.type设置为ClusterIP,以确保安装不受Kubernetes网络环境影响。可结合自身研发环境来选择使用NodePort或LoadBalancer服务类型来暴露NocalhostServer。完成操作,开始创建:片刻后:2暴露服务进入「应用负载」下的「服务」页面,选择nocalhost-web服务,在最右侧的拉下菜单中选择「编辑外部访问」:在弹出的对话
一:灵感问题(难点) 在利用python中的matplotlib绘制双y轴图像(条形图+折线图)过程中,为了防止折线图被条形图遮挡,我们需要先绘制条形图,而后绘制折线图,大致效果图如下: (这里为了看得更清楚对一些线条做了加宽处理) 这里我们可以发现:先画的条形图默认使用了左侧的y轴,而后画的折线图默认使用了右侧的y轴。但个人看图习惯加上强迫症想让后画的折线图使用的y轴在左侧,而先画的条形图使用的y轴在右侧,这该如何调整?二:调整思路 前期的一些绘制双y轴图像所需要的基础代码:导入模块-修改字体-输入统计数据-创建图像对象-添加子图(创建轴对象);#importthem
Python中有多种OCR库可供使用,包括Tesseract、EasyOCR、pytesseract等。下面是一个使用pytesseract库进行OCR识别的Python代码示例:pythonimportpytesseractfromPILimportImage#加载图像image=Image.open('example.png')#进行OCR识别text=pytesseract.image_to_string(image,lang='eng')#输出识别结果print(text)在这个示例中,我们首先使用PIL库加载了一个名为"example.png"的图像。然后,我们调用image_to_
ansible/ansibleStars:59.6kLicense:GPL-3.0Ansible是一个极其简单的IT自动化系统,它处理配置管理、应用部署、云提供、临时任务执行、网络自动化和多节点编排。Ansible使得像零停机滚动更新与负载均衡器一样复杂的更改变得容易。主要功能包括:极其简单的设置过程和最小学习曲线快速并行地管理计算机通过利用现有SSH守护程序实现无代理,并避免使用定制代理和额外开放端口使用既适合人类又适合机器阅读的语言描述基础设施注重安全性以及内容易审计/审核/重新编写除此之外还具备以下核心优势:可以立即管理新远程计算机而不需要引导任何软件;支持在任何动态语言中进行模块开发,